FTX Creditors Set to Receive Allocations Through Kraken: $5 Billion Payment Round Underway 💸
In a noteworthy turn of events for the cryptocurrency sector, FTX creditors have started to receive their financial allocations through Kraken accounts.
This revelation comes after a recent announcement by Sunil, a representative for the FTX creditors, on social media. He confirmed that the allocation process is progressing well as part of a $5 billion payment distribution.
